Η κατανόηση της οργάνωσης υπολογιστών είναι ζωτικής σημασίας για διάφορους λόγους, τόσο για άτομα που ενδιαφέρονται για την τεχνολογία όσο και για τους επαγγελματίες που εργάζονται στον τομέα:
1. Αποτελεσματικός προγραμματισμός και ανάπτυξη:
* Κατανόηση της αλληλεπίδρασης υλικού-software: Η γνώση του τρόπου αλληλεπίδρασης των στοιχείων υλικού με το λογισμικό επιτρέπει στους προγραμματιστές να γράφουν πιο αποτελεσματικό και βελτιστοποιημένο κώδικα. Αυτό περιλαμβάνει την κατανόηση της διαχείρισης της μνήμης, της ροής δεδομένων και του τρόπου επεξεργασίας των οδηγιών.
* Βελτιστοποίηση εντοπισμού σφαλμάτων και απόδοσης: Όταν προκύπτουν προβλήματα, η κατανόηση της οργάνωσης υπολογιστών βοηθά στην εντοπισμό της πηγής του προβλήματος, είτε πρόκειται για δυσλειτουργία υλικού είτε για σφάλμα λογισμικού. Επιτρέπει επίσης τη βελτιστοποίηση του λογισμικού για συγκεκριμένες αρχιτεκτονικές υλικού, μεγιστοποιώντας την απόδοση.
* Ανάπτυξη για διαφορετικές πλατφόρμες: Η κατανόηση της υποκείμενης αρχιτεκτονικής επιτρέπει στους προγραμματιστές να προσαρμόσουν τις εφαρμογές τους για διάφορες πλατφόρμες, όπως κινητές συσκευές, ενσωματωμένα συστήματα και συστάδες υψηλής απόδοσης.
2. Σχεδιασμός και οικοδόμηση καινοτόμων συστημάτων:
* Δημιουργία νέου υλικού και λογισμικού: Οι αρχιτέκτονες και οι μηχανικοί βασίζονται σε μια βαθιά κατανόηση της οργάνωσης υπολογιστών για να σχεδιάσουν νέα στοιχεία υλικού, να αναπτύξουν καινοτόμες λύσεις λογισμικού και να βελτιώσουν τα υπάρχοντα συστήματα.
* Αναδυόμενες τεχνολογίες μόχλευσης: Η κατανόηση του τρόπου λειτουργίας των εξαρτημάτων επιτρέπει στους μηχανικούς να εκμεταλλευτούν τις αναδυόμενες τεχνολογίες όπως η παράλληλη επεξεργασία, η κβαντική πληροφορική και η τεχνητή νοημοσύνη, οδηγώντας σε προόδους σε διάφορους τομείς.
* Ανάπτυξη ενσωματωμένων συστημάτων: Η οργάνωση υπολογιστών είναι ζωτικής σημασίας για την οικοδόμηση ενσωματωμένων συστημάτων, όπως αυτά που βρίσκονται σε αυτοκίνητα, συσκευές και ιατρικές συσκευές, που απαιτούν προσεκτική εξέταση της κατανάλωσης ενέργειας, απόδοσης σε πραγματικό χρόνο και περιορισμών πόρων.
3. Λήψη τεκμηριωμένων αποφάσεων:
* Επιλογή του σωστού υλικού: Η κατανόηση της οργάνωσης υπολογιστών βοηθά τους χρήστες να λαμβάνουν τεκμηριωμένες αποφάσεις κατά την αγορά υπολογιστών, εξασφαλίζοντας ότι θα λάβουν τα σωστά στοιχεία για τις συγκεκριμένες ανάγκες τους.
* Αξιολόγηση της απόδοσης του συστήματος: Η κατανόηση του τρόπου με τον οποίο τα διάφορα στοιχεία συμβάλλουν στη συνολική απόδοση βοηθούν τους χρήστες να αξιολογούν τις δυνατότητες ενός συστήματος και να κάνουν ενημερωμένες επιλογές σχετικά με αναβαθμίσεις λογισμικού ή αντικαταστάσεις υλικού.
* Κατανόηση της ασφάλειας και της ιδιωτικής ζωής των δεδομένων: Η γνώση της οργάνωσης των υπολογιστών είναι απαραίτητη για την κατανόηση του τρόπου αποθήκευσης και επεξεργασίας των δεδομένων, επιτρέποντας ενημερωμένες αποφάσεις σχετικά με τα μέτρα ασφαλείας και τις πρακτικές απορρήτου δεδομένων.
4. Κατανόηση του μέλλοντος της πληροφορικής:
* Μείνετε μπροστά από την καμπύλη: Η κατανόηση της οργάνωσης υπολογιστών επιτρέπει στα άτομα να συμβαδίζουν με το ταχέως μεταβαλλόμενο τοπίο της τεχνολογίας. Αυτό περιλαμβάνει την κατανόηση των νέων αρχιτεκτονικών, των αναδυόμενων τεχνολογιών και των επιπτώσεων για τα μελλοντικά υπολογιστικά συστήματα.
* Συμβολή στην τεχνολογική πρόοδο: Με την κατανόηση των βασικών στοιχείων της οργάνωσης υπολογιστών, τα άτομα μπορούν να συμβάλουν στην ανάπτυξη και την προώθηση της τεχνολογίας, οδηγώντας την καινοτομία σε διάφορους τομείς.
Συμπερασματικά:
Η οργάνωση υπολογιστών δεν είναι απλώς ένα τεχνικό θέμα, αλλά ένα θεμέλιο για την κατανόηση των θεμελιωδών αρχών πίσω από τον ψηφιακό κόσμο στον οποίο ζούμε. Δίνει τη δυνατότητα στα άτομα να λαμβάνουν τεκμηριωμένες αποφάσεις, να σχεδιάζουν και να αναπτύσσουν καινοτόμα συστήματα και να παραμένουν μπροστά από την καμπύλη στο συνεχώς εξελισσόμενο τομέα υπολογιστών.
Πνευματικά δικαιώματα © Γνώση Υπολογιστών Όλα τα δικαιώματα κατοχυρωμένα